Educational ProgramsSaint Jude Catholic SchoolClick here to visit Saint Jude School's website. RCIA Program ... (Adults)RCIA stands for Rite of Christian Initiation of Adults. The RCIA Program at St. Jude Parish is designed to assist those who either wish to become a Roman Catholic or are already Catholic and seeking to complete their initiation into the Church through the Sacraments of Baptism, Eucharist, and Confirmation. Although those who attend RCIA may come from a variety of religious and non-religious backgrounds, they are all responding to a common call to grow in their relationship with Christ through a deeper and ongoing conversion of heart. The Religious Education Program at St. Jude Parish prepares our children, teens, and adults to both learn about the Catholic faith and to receive the Sacraments of Baptism, Reconciliation, Eucharist, and Confirmation. All students are instructed in the Gospel values of Jesus Christ with emphasis on understanding what it truly means to live and worship as a Roman Catholic. It is the goal of the Religious Education process to awaken the faith of each student by facilitating a genuine discovery and understanding of the active presence of God in the life of the Church and the World. ![]() ![]() Sacramental Preparation In accordance with the norms of the Diocese of Palm Beach, preparation for First Communion and First Reconciliation is done in the First and Second Grades of Religious Education. Preparation for the Sacrament of Confirmation is done in the Eight and Ninth Grades. However, special Sacraments sessions are available for those students who are beyond these grades and are still in need of sacraments. Life Teen MinistryThis ministry includes Mass which provides a real connection for the teens in our community. This allows them to take ownership of their faith so that going to Mass is not just their "parent's thing to do" anymore. The Life Teen Mass is geared toward reaching out to teens where they are and helping them to develop a relationship with Jesus that is both personal and real. The LIFE TEEN Mass is followed by LIFE NIGHT in the Atrium of St. Jude School. During the LIFE NIGHT, teens gather to learn about the church and to explore their faith in challenging new ways. The LIFE TEEN MASS AND LIFE NIGHT are designed to reach out, to deal with and to meet the real needs of today's teens.
